top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    : 全面解析以太坊区块链钱包设计:安全性、可用

    • 2025-07-06 03:35:31
          ---

          在数字货币的快速发展过程中,以太坊作为一种流行的区块链平台,吸引了广泛的开发者和用户,推动了其生态系统的不断壮大。以太坊的智能合约功能使其超越了比特币,成为了更为复杂的去中心化应用(DApps)的基础。在这样的背景下,设计一个安全、易用且能提供良好用户体验的钱包显得尤为重要。

          本篇文章将深入探讨以太坊区块链钱包的设计,分析其中的重要考虑因素,如安全性、用户友好性以及多平台支持等。同时,我们也将解答常见的相关问题,帮助用户更好地理解和使用以太坊钱包。

          以太坊钱包的安全性设计

          安全性是任何加密货币钱包设计的重中之重。以太坊钱包的安全性包括但不限于密钥管理、交易验证、用户身份认证等多个方面。

          首先,密钥管理至关重要。以太坊钱包通常分为热钱包和冷钱包。热钱包连接互联网,适合频繁交易,但因此易受网络攻击。而冷钱包则是离线存储,虽然使用不便,但安全性较高。因此,在设计以太坊钱包时,应提供多种存储方式供用户选择,满足不同的安全需求。

          其次,交易验证机制也是确保钱包安全的重要环节。钱包使用多种方法来验证交易,比如双重认证(2FA)技术和多重签名(Multisig)方案,以降低单点故障的风险。这些措施能够有效防止未授权访问,保护用户资产不受侵害。

          另外,用户身份认证手段也在不断演进。除了传统的用户名/密码组合,越来越多的钱包开始使用生物识别技术,例如指纹识别和面部识别,提升安全性与用户体验。但在这方面也必须平衡好便捷性与安全性,避免因过于复杂的认证流程而影响用户流失。

          用户体验的设计

          除了安全性,用户体验同样是以太坊钱包设计不可忽视的方面。用户界面的简洁、直观性以及提供的功能都对用户的满意度有直接影响。

          首先,用户界面(UI)设计是影响用户体验的关键因素。设计一款以太坊钱包时,应注重界面的美观和易用性,尤其是新用户进入的时候。复杂的操作流程和繁琐的功能设置可能会使用户感到困惑。因此,提供直观的导航,清晰的指示以及相应的教程会大大提升用户的初体验。

          其次,钱包功能的设置也应该考虑到用户的实际需求。常见的功能如发送和接收以太币、查看交易记录、管理ERC20代币、查询市场价格等都应齐全。同时,能够提供多语言支持也是提升用户体验的一种有效方式,特别是在全球范围内用户基数不断增加的背景下。

          最后,钱包的响应速度和性能也是体验的重要一环。用户在进行交易时,快速流畅的操作能够显著提高他们的满意度。因此,在设计时应对代码进行,确保在高并发情况下仍然能够稳定运行。

          以太坊钱包的多平台支持

          为了满足不同用户的需求,以太坊钱包应支持多种平台,包括桌面端、移动端和网页端。这不仅能增强用户的使用灵活性,也为钱包的推广奠定了基础。

          在桌面端,用户通常需要安全、强大的钱包,因此桌面钱包应该提供更多的功能和设置选项。用户在使用桌面钱包时,能够享受较为完善的交易功能以及更为复杂的安全设置。

          移动端钱包则更加注重便捷性和即时性。用户可以随时随地进行交易,通常会希望钱包具有良好的界面友好性和快速响应能力。此外,移动钱包应当兼顾手机的安全性,支持生物识别等身份验证方式。

          对于网页钱包,容易使用和方便接入是主要优势。用户在访问网页钱包时,不需要下载任何软件,直接通过浏览器即可使用。然而,这种方式安全性相对较低,因此需要通过强加密和安全协议来保护用户信息和交易。

          以太坊钱包的集成与拓展

          随着以太坊生态系统的不断发展,集成第三方服务和API也是当前钱包设计的重要方向。通过与去中心化交易所(DEX)、其他DApps以及交换服务集成,钱包能够为用户提供更加丰富的功能。

          例如,用户可以通过钱包直接与DEX进行交易,省去提供私钥等繁琐步骤,提升交易的便利性和安全性。同时,集成其他DApp用户也能更好地通过钱包进行选择和交互,这种无缝连接会使得用户粘性提高,从而提高钱包的市场竞争力。

          此外,拓展现有钱包的功能,例如支持多链资产管理,也在日益成为一种趋势。随着众多公链和相应的资产涌现,钱包不仅仅局限于以太坊网络。能管理跨链资产的钱包近年来受到越来越多用户的青睐,因此,在这种情况下,设计者需关注不同区块链间的互操作性,以及如何在保持安全的前提下实现良好的用户体验。

          常见问题与解答

          在使用以太坊钱包的过程中,用户常常会遇到各种问题。为了帮助大家更好地理解和使用以太坊钱包,以下将列出五个常见问题,并进行详细解答。

          1. 如何选择适合自己的以太坊钱包?

          选择一个适合自己的以太坊钱包需要考虑多个因素,首先是安全性,钱包应该具备加密技术,并有用户自定义的私钥管理选项;其次,是钱包的类型,热钱包和冷钱包各有优缺点,用户需要根据自己的需求来选择;第三是用户体验,界面友好与否直接影响使用的便利性;最后是功能,查看钱包是否支持ERC20代币、NFT等。

          2. 如何保障以太坊钱包的安全性?

          保障以太坊钱包安全性的方法包括:使用强密码并定期更换,开启双重认证,使用硬件钱包隔离私钥,定期备份钱包数据;同时,用户需要谨慎处理网络环境,避免在公共Wi-Fi下进行大额转账,并定期检查交易记录,以及时发现任何异常行为。

          3. 如何恢复丢失的以太坊钱包?

          恢复丢失的以太坊钱包通常依赖于助记词或私钥,许多钱包在初次创建时会生成一组助记词,用户需妥善保存。如果用户遗失了私钥和助记词,通常无法恢复钱包资产。因此,建议用户在创建钱包时,一定要将助记词和私钥安全存放在离线环境中。

          4. 以太坊钱包的手续费如何计算?

          以太坊钱包的手续费通常由网络的拥堵情况和用户设置的优先级决定。用户在发送交易时,可以根据网络状况选择手续费高低,手续费越高,交易处理的速度越快。不同钱包对于手续费的展示和计算方式可能有所不同,用户需根据自己的信息进行选择。

          5. 使用以太坊钱包进行交易的流程是怎样的?

          使用以太坊钱包进行交易的流程通常包括:首先,打开钱包,确认并输入接收方的地址;其次,输入转账金额以及选择手续费;最后确认交易信息无误后提交交易。交易提交后,用户可以在钱包内查看交易状态,等待区块确认。

          总之,在设计一款优秀的以太坊钱包,需要多方面的考虑,包括安全性、用户体验、平台兼容等。而解答这些常见问题可以帮助用户在使用过程中更好地把握钱包的特性以及如何保护自己的资产。

          • Tags
          • 关键词:以太坊钱包,区块链安全,用户体验